Inside Cameroon's Hardwood Lump Charcoal Factory: Processes and Sustainability
A typical Cameroonian hardwood lump charcoal plant represents a fascinating combination of traditional practices and modern efficiency . The procedure begins with the sourcing of sustainably cultivated hardwood trees, predominantly species like African Teak and Iroko. These logs are then carefully placed onto kilns , large metal structures designed for controlled decomposition . The wood is slowly heated in a low oxygen environment, transforming it into charcoal – a concentrated form of carbon. Skilled laborers control the heat and airflow to ensure optimal standard and production. While common methods often caused significant waste , modern plants are increasingly implementing strategies to recover byproducts, such as wood vinegar and vapors , for energy production or fertilizer, promoting a more sustainable operation. Challenges remain, however, in securing consistent uniformity and addressing the potential of deforestation if procurement isn't rigorously managed .
